>   In a system of multi cpu core, with multiple crypto hardware, different irq 
> for each, is it possible the udp receive get out of order for the same tfm?
>  
> Let us say, of the same tfm, driver distributes requests to any available 
> crypto hardware.  For the same tfm, driver re-sequences response before 
> complete callout to the same arrival sequence of the requests. The complete 
> callout is running at tasklet level of the system.
> 
> Each irq is assigned to a different irq affinity cpu core to improve the 
> performance. Therefore the iprecv and ipsec processing can be done by 
> multiple cpu cores at the same time for the same tfm/udp.
> 
> I am seeing the following -   if I assign irq affinity to different cpu 
> cores, iperf server of udp session displays receive out of order message. If 
> I assign them to the same core, or take default, then message stops. The 
> assignment is done by hand while the system is running, by updating  
> /proc/irq/xxx/smp_affinity, where xxx is the irq number. This scenario is 
> very repeatable. 
> 
> We are on linux-3.10.
> 
> Does it make sense?

Are we talking about an in-tree driver? If so which one?

It's not certainly not meant to change packet ordering.
